hello everyone ..... i will share the root trick without ubl (unlock bootloader)
this method only applies to root magisk only.
this trick I have tested with mobile phone huawei y5 2017 with android version 6.0
and xiaomi redmi note 3 mtk ..
what you prepare as follows:
1.Firmware same with your phone type (my recommendation is flash FW on your phone)
2.Boot.img from the appropriate firmware of your phone type
3.magisk manager
execution steps:
1. make sure the phone is connected internet
2. open the phone settings to activate usb debugging and install the source check from the outside in the security settings.
3. copy boot.img into sdcard on phone
4. install magisk manager application and open the application,
go to the settings on the top left and search "booted boot output format and you can choose according to your needs (if select img.tar, this works with Odin samsung). make your choice (if img = flash with fastboot or spflashtool, ufibox.
go back and select pairs and you will see 3 options "download zip, patch boot img file, install "
please select "patch img boot file" select file and search boot.img stored in sdcard and ok ... magisk manager will download automatically ... just wait until there is installation process is complete.
after finished you see its results in the internal memory in the folder "magisk manager"
there is a file named "patched_boot.img" that means success
copy patched_boot.img to laptop / pc and rename it to "boot.img" and flash it with the appropriate tool of your phone.
if boot.tar in flash with odin
if boot.img flash with spflashtool (if your chipset is mtk)
just install patched_boot.img your phone is rooted
thanks to @topjohnwu
I am sorry, my English is not good
*remember that all the risks in modification are at risk and I am not responsible for all your failures .....
thanks for visiting and hopefully to suc ...
Does this work with Sony Xperia X Performance (Android oreo) that has ubl no?
Related
Hello everyone
I hope somebody can help me. I have a Huawei y6 scc-u21 that I need to fix. I have downloaded a firmware flash file to reflash the phone however, after doing so, I found that the gapps are not installed. I tried to download and install every update but still I did not have gapps installed.
Also, I noticed that after flashing and everytime I do a factory reset, the phone would not prompt me to a setup process and just automatically goes to the normal interface. Some settings are missing too.
Please help. Without GAPPS this phone is basically useless. Doesn't even get a signal even though a SIM card is inserted.
Thanks.
I had the same problem.. here is what i do to solve it:
1- download u21 cm2 backup file from here:
http://www.mobilekse.com/2018/09/huawei-y6-scc-u2131-all-file-firmware.html?m=1
2. Extract it with 7zip.
3 download an sd card update "update.app".
4. install the update with sd card.
5- extract the file with "huawei update extractor" and get "BOOT.img" , "ABOOT.img" and "CUST.img" rename them to lowercase and put them to the folder of the first firmware of step 1/
6- open qfil, select flat buit, select the programmer path from the firmware folder then select from the top: tools then partition manager.
7- select boot.img partition and with a right click select manage partition.
8- choose the boot.img extracted and replaced.
9- do the same for aboot.img and cust.img
10- the phone will exit this dump mode and you will find playstore, keyboard, notfications..
Ask me if you found anything not clear
this is a guide for some user running stock Realme UI 2 on rooted device. while stock recovery wont work after unlocking bootloader and magisk installed (UPDATE: apparently stock recovery are working but you have to wait around 30minutes in order to boot into it). the only option for us is using custom recovery. but custom recovery wont recognize the updates because it's unusual format and its unusual location. Be careful!! I'm not responsible for any damage you may encounter doing this guide. I will try to help as far as I could do
(this guide are documentation from rui2.0 c.09 to c.15 update. where rui1.0 to rui2.0 upgrade im using stock recovery )
first of all, we need to download updates from ota server. simply enter Settings app, scroll down and select Software update. wait untill finished, you'll be prompted to install when it's done. but don't have to do that, it only reboot to recovery doing nothing.
now preparing the updates.
the downloaded files are located inside
Code:
/data/ota_package/OTA/.otaPackage
there are 6 files (may vary) and all of them are flashable zips except system_vendor that needs slight modification. copy or move those files to internal or external storage (i personally put those files on /sdcard/updates/). then add .zip extension by renaming (put ".zip" in the end of file name).
modifying system_vendor.zip
extract system_vendor into separate folder. after that, navigate to META-INF/com/google/android/ now edit updater-script replace RMX2151L1 (or similar) with RMX2151 to avoid installation errors. on TWRP, this phone is only recognized as RMX2151 regardless it's actual phone model ( it needs confirmation from other realme 7 users ).
now back to system_vendor folder and replace vbmeta.img file with vbmeta from attachment. after doing all steps simply repack all files and folder into zip with normal compression parameter. (you don't have to replace vbmeta file, but you have to flash modified vbmeta after that to avoid bootloop)
all files are ready to flash using TWRP (or your own preferred custom recovery). flashing this zip might replace bootloader with stock so flashing Magisk are preferred or you'll lose root access.
the intention of making this thread are opening discussion about realme updates. maybe someone out there could make all those steps simpler and easy enough
Instructions for unlocking the bootloader on Android 12 (Realme UI 3.0).
1. First of all, you need to roll back to Android 10 (Realme UI 1.0) in this way — https://4pda.to/forum/index.php?showtopic=1018185&view=findpost&p=108649502 .
2. Then unlock the bootloader according to the instructions from here — https://4pda.to/forum/index.php?showtopic=1018185&view=findpost&p=108311204 .
3. After you will need to download the Android 11 firmware (Realme UI 2.0) from this link — http://rms01.realme.net/SW/realme service/realme 7 5G/20680/RMX2111GDPR_11_C.09_2022011518240000.zip .
4. After that, you need to unpack it to any folder on your PC. Next , you find a file with the extension in the unpacked files .ofp and unpack it using the MCT OFP Extractor program to another separate folder.
6. After completing the process, you search in the resulting file folder for four files that are parts of the super partition image with the .img extension. Having found them, you open the folder with adb tools and run from it
the command line, after which the smartphone, switched to Fastboot mode (it can also be flashed in Fastbootd, is flashed both there and there), connect to the PC and flash these files in the order in which they are located in the folder with this command, changing only the name of the file being flashed:
fastboot flash super file name.img
7. At the end, you run the program to bypass the protection in the SP Flash Tool and this utility itself, specify in it as Scatter and Authentication files the files from the last folder (into which the extension file was unpacked.ofp), connect a smartphone in Bootrom mode, disable protection and flash all remaining files.
8. Then you download this Android 12 firmware (Realme UI 3.0) — https://rms01.realme.net/sw/RMX2111GDPR_11_F.04_2022080921130000.zip and repeat steps 4 to 7, flashing files already from it.
In the end, you will get a smartphone on the latest firmware with an unlocked bootloader, if you do everything right.
Not working
Hi. How to fix it ?
IMPORTANT
Rooting can break your phone. Do this at your own risk.
Intro
This guide explains how you can root any Sony Android phone without installing a custom recovery like TWRP. It's possible by downloading the latest firmware, patching the boot IMG file with Magisk and flashing the patched boot IMG.
Note 1:
If you have the XQ-AU52_EU_59.2.A.0.463-R14C firmware installed (Sony Xperia 10 II EU Android 12), you can skip downloading the firmware and converting the file from SIN to IMG. Flash the patched "boot.img" file in the attachment instead.
Note 2:
If you don't like the skin that's installed along Android 12 on the Sony Xperia 10 II, you can downgrade the firmware by using Sony Xperia Flash Tool - Emma.
Note 3:
All files I collected are available
How to
Install all Android updates on your phone
Back-up your phone with a tool or Google back-up
Unlock the bootloader (wipes all data on your phone)
Sony users:
https://developer.sony.com/develop/...d/unlock-bootloader/how-to-unlock-bootloader/
Download the latest firmware
Sony users can use XperiFirm which you will find in the attachment
Make sure the version you download matches the one on your phone!
Convert the “boot SIN” file you just downloaded to IMG:
Drag the “boot SIN” file to “unsin.exe” and an IMG file will be created
(you will find "unsin.exe" in the attachment)
Copy the IMG file to your phone
Copy Magisk APK to your phone
(you will find Magisk in the attachment)
Install Magisk on your phone using the APK you copied
Open Magisk on your phone
Install Magisk (button in the app) and patch the “boot IMG” file you just copied
Get the files for ADB (platform-tools)
(you will find the files in the attachment)
Copy the patched “boot IMG” file to the “adb” folder on your pc and rename it to “boot.img”
Enable USB debugging on the phone:
a) Settings » About » Tap “Build” until you a message appears you are a developer
b) Settings » Advanced » Developer » USB debugging
Open a CMD window in the “adb” folder
a) Press the “Windows botton”
b) Type "cmd"
c) Click "Command Prompt"
d) Type "cd /d <path to directory with adb.exe file – i.e. c:\myfolder\adb>"
Start the phone in “fastboot” mode:
a) Turn the phone off
b) Press the "volume-up" button and connect the USB cable at the same time
Install the USB drivers
(you will find the files in the attachment)
Run "fastboot flash boot boot.img" (watch the file name)
Disconnect the cable and turn the phone on
Download "Root Checker" from the Play Store and open it
Tap "Check Root"
A popup will appear to grand root access to the Root Checker app
If a message stating "ROOTED" appears your phone is succesfully rooted
That's it!
I want to root my device. Will twrp 3.6.0 from mastersenpai05 work on MIUI 14.0.1?
it seems to me that this TWRP is A11 and MIUI 14 A13.
No need for TWRP to root.
Root:
1. Find or redownload the TGZ file for your current ROM or other rom.
2. Browse inside the zip file and find boot.img under the images folder
3. Copy this file to a temporary location in your PC first, and then transfer it to your phone
4. Install the desired version of Magisk app
5. Run the app and choose Install under Magisk
6. Choose Select and Patch a File, then select the boot.img that was transferred earlier
7. A process will run and create a new .img file in the same folder where the original one was
8. Transfer the new file to your PC in the same directory where fastboot.exe is located
9. Open a command prompt window in that same directory
10. Reboot your phone to fastboot mode and connect to PC, USB2.0 port. Check for connection by running command fastboot devices.
11. Run the command fastboot flash boot_ab magiskXXXX.img
***On some devices, disable-verity is required.
Once it's completed, run command fastboot reboot and the phone should boot and be rooted.